Gemological Institute of America-Carlsbad vs. UEI College-West Covina
Both Gemological Institute of America-Carlsbad and UEI College-West Covina are Less than 2 years schools located in California. The following statements compare Gemological Institute of America-Carlsbad and UEI College-West Covina with important academic statistics including tuition, test scores, and admission rate.
- Both schools are private.
- Gemological Institute of America-Carlsbad's tuition ($23,453) is more expensive than UEI College-West Covina ($21,500).
- Gemological Institute of America-Carlsbad's students to faculty ratio (9 to 1) is lower than UEI College-West Covina (20 to 1).
- UEI College-West Covina (1,022 students) is larger than Gemological Institute of America-Carlsbad (308 students) with more enrolled students.
- Gemological Institute of America-Carlsbad ($13,947) has higher amount of financial aid than UEI College-West Covina ($4,548).
- UEI College-West Covina's graduation rate (65%) is higher than Gemological Institute of America-Carlsbad (28%).
